Placing and Surface area
By far the most clear distinction between indoor and Seaside volleyball lies while in the enjoying surface area. Indoor volleyball is performed on a tough court, ordinarily manufactured from Wooden or synthetic products, furnishing a easy and constant playing subject. This allows for faster movement, higher jumps, plus more explosive attacks.

In contrast, Seashore volleyball is performed on sand, which slows down movement and absorbs Electricity from jumps. The sand helps make functioning and diving a lot more bodily demanding, often resulting in for a longer period rallies that require endurance and method in lieu of just velocity and power.

Group Composition
One more major change is team size. Indoor volleyball attributes six gamers for each group, Each and every by using a specified part—setter, libero, outdoors hitter, Center blocker, and many others. This specialization lets players to concentrate on mastering specific skills in the program of the staff.

Beach volleyball is played with just two gamers on all sides, and there aren't any preset positions. Equally athletes must serve, set, strike, block, and protect—making versatility a vital need. With no substitutions allowed, Seaside volleyball players must be well-rounded and resilient all through the full match.

Court docket Proportions
The indoor volleyball court docket steps eighteen meters by 9 meters, even though the Seashore volleyball courtroom is a little smaller at sixteen meters by eight meters. Irrespective of much less gamers, the more compact Seaside court size demonstrates the Actual physical constraints of actively playing on sand and makes certain rallies continue being competitive.

Game Structure and Scoring
The two versions use rally scoring, indicating a point is awarded on every serve. Nevertheless, the match structure differs:

Indoor volleyball: Greatest-of-5 sets, with Every single of the very first four sets performed to twenty five points and a choosing fifth established to fifteen.

Beach volleyball: Finest-of-three sets, with the primary two sets performed to 21 details as well as the 3rd, if desired, to fifteen.

All sets in the two formats have to be gained by a two-level margin.

Environmental Components
Indoor volleyball Advantages from a managed local climate—no wind, no sun, and also lighting. This regularity permits exact and strong Enjoy.
